What is the effect of increasing the gain in a proportional controller?
  • Step 1: Understand what a proportional controller does. It adjusts the output based on the difference between the desired value (setpoint) and the actual value (process variable).
  • Step 2: Know that 'gain' in a proportional controller is a number that determines how much the output changes in response to the error (the difference between setpoint and process variable).
  • Step 3: Realize that increasing the gain means the controller will react more strongly to the error. This means bigger changes in output for the same amount of error.
  • Step 4: Understand that while a higher gain can make the system respond faster, it can also make the system less stable.
  • Step 5: Recognize that decreased stability can lead to oscillations, where the output keeps going up and down instead of settling at the desired value.
